 CAREER SUMMARY
2024-25 (Senior)
  • Appeared and started in all 32 games
  • Totaled 549 points with 187 rebounds
  • Added 92 assists, 43 blocks, and 33 steals
  • Academic All-AMC
  • All-AMC First Team
  • All-AMC Defensive Team
  • NAIA Daktronics Scholar Athlete
  • AMC Player of the Week (Defensive - Nov. 4 / Offensive - Nov. 25, Feb. 17)
  • All-time leading scorer with 2,197 points
  • Broke multiple program records:
    • most field goals in a career (849)
    • Highest field goal percentage in a game (100%, 10-10) versus the University of Health Sciences and Pharmacy (Mo.) (1/20/25)
    • Most free throw attempts in a career (575)
    • Most free throws made in a career (446)
  • Moved to third all-time in rebounding (827)
2023-24 (Junior)
  • Started in 31 games
  • Averaged 15.1 ppg, 5.7 rpg, and 2.7 apg
  • Produced 483 points, 181 rebounds, and 85 assists
  • Scored a season-high of 34 points against UHSP (Mo.)
  • Shot 44-percent from the field, 28-percent from three, and 82-percent from the free throw line
  • Moved to third all-time in career points
  • Moved to fourth all-time in career blocks with 124
  • Moved to ninth all-time in career assists at 297
  • AMC Tournament MVP
  • All-AMC First-Team
  • All-AMC Defensive Team
  • Academic All-AMC
  • College Sports Communicators Academic All-District
2022-23 (Junior)
  • Started in all 31 games
  • Averaged 12.4 points, 5.9 rebounds, and 2.7 assists
  • Scored a career-high of 36 points against Missouri Baptist
  • Led the Cougars in scoring with 283 points
  • Led Columbia in assists with 2.7 per game
  • Achieved a career-high of 36 points against Missouri Baptist (2/4/23)
  • Totaled 383 points, 85 assists, 33 blocks, and 25 steals
  • Shot 48.2-percent from the field and 72.2-percent from the line
  • AMC Tournament MVP
  • Academic All-AMC
  • All-AMC First-Team
  • All-AMC Defensive Team
  • NAIA All-American Honorable Mention

2021-22 (Covid - Sophomore)
  • Started in all 32 games
  • Averaged 15.8 points per game while accumulating 507 points
  • Posted a season-high of 23 points against Missouri Baptist and Rio Grande (Ohio)
  • Shot 46.9-percent from the field and 75.2-percent from the free throw line
  • Brought down 168 rebounds, dished out 97 assists, and recorded 37 blocks
  • First-Team All-Conference
  • Academic All-AMC
  • NAIA All-American Honorable Mention
  • WBCA NAIA Coaches' All-American

2020-21 (Freshman)
  • Started in all 21 games
  • Averaged 13.1 points, 5.1 rebounds, 1.7 assists, and 1.5 steals per game
  • Shot 41.4-percent from the field, 29.5-percent from behind the 3-point arc and 78.2-percent from the foul line
  • Scored a season-high 21 points against Hannibal-LaGrange
  • AMC Freshman of the Year
  • First-Team All-AMC
  • AMC All-Freshman Team
  • NAIA All-American Honorable Mention
  • WBCA NAIA Coaches' All-American
  • Academic All-AMC
  • AMC Player of the Week (1)
